Episode 5: Law from the Mountain – Moses and the Birth of Mosaic Law

from Historia Juris: A Layman's Guide to the History of the Law · host Randy Scudder, Esq.

What if law was meant to shape not just behavior—but character, community, and justice itself?In this episode of Historia Juris, we explore Mosaic Law as one of the most influential legal systems in human history. Far more than a collection of religious commandments, Mosaic Law functioned as a comprehensive legal and ethical framework governing crime, family life, property, contracts, worship, and communal responsibility.We examine how these laws introduced revolutionary ideas for the ancient world: equality before the law, proportional justice, procedural safeguards, and the belief that law must serve moral ends rather than raw power. From criminal justice to economic fairness, Mosaic Law sought to restrain authority, protect human dignity, and bind rulers and citizens alike to the same legal standard.The episode then traces Mosaic Law’s enduring influence across time—through Jewish legal tradition, early Christian ethics, Islamic jurisprudence, medieval European law, and Enlightenment‑era natural law theory. Even in modern secular legal systems, its moral assumptions remain unmistakable.This episode asks a fundamental question: Is law merely what the state enforces—or does it carry an ethical obligation that transcends authority itself?
